    Medicare

    Medicare Special Enrollment Period

    A Medicare Special Enrollment Period lets you sign up for Medicare outside the usual windows because of life events like losing job-based coverage.

    Who qualifies for Medicare Special Enrollment Period?+

    Most people 65+, plus some younger people with qualifying disabilities or end-stage renal disease.

    How do I apply for Medicare Special Enrollment Period?+

    Most people are enrolled automatically at 65. To pick a plan or sign up manually, go to medicare.gov or call your free SHIP counselor. Official forms and instructions: https://www.medicare.gov/basics/get-started-with-medicare/sign-up/special-enrollment-periods.

    Where can I get help?+

    Call your free State Health Insurance Assistance Program (SHIP) for one-on-one Medicare counseling at no cost, or compare plans at medicare.gov.
